Cost of Living Calculator - Greenville, North Carolina vs Flemington, New Jersey


The cost of living in Flemington, New Jersey is 52.5% more expensive than Greenville, North Carolina.

You would need a salary of $76,247 in Flemington, New Jersey to maintain the standard of living you have in Greenville, North Carolina.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Flemington, New Jersey is more expensive than Greenville, North Carolina
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
